Anhydrous calcium chloride is a very hygroscopic compound, meaning that it readily absorbs water. It can even dissolve, in fact, in the water it absorbs from the surrounding atmosphere. Calcium chloride pellets in a drying tube act as desiccants or drying agents, removing moisture from the air that flows through them.
